Bio

At CMS
Enters junior season tied for second in CMS history in the 400-meter hurdles (53.10). 

2019-20 (Junior)
Competed in four meets before the suspension of spring sports ... Capped off the year by winning both events he competed in at a five-team SCIAC Multi-Dual at Whittier, taking first in the 400 hurdles (56.63) and the 4x400 relay ... Also helped the 4x400 relay team to a win at the CMS Outdoor Indoor Distance Challenge Meet to start the season ... Came in ninth in the 400 meters at the Pomona-Pitzer All-Comers in 50.31 ... Was third in the 400 hurdles at the CMS Rossi Relays in 54.94. 

2018-19 (Sophomore)
SCIAC Champion (400 hurdles, 4x400 Relay) ... USTFCCCA All-West Region (400 hurdles, 4x400 Relay) ... NCAA Qualifier (400 hurdles) ... SCIAC Track Athlete of the Week (March 25) ... 
Won the 400 hurdles at the SCIAC Championships with a time of 53.10, tying for the second-fastest in CMS history ... Also ran the first leg of the 4x400 relay that won the SCIAC title with a 3:19.43, capping off the Stags team championship ... Finished 17th at the NCAA Division III Championships in the 400 hurdles ... Earned the SCIAC Track Athlete of the Week after a second-place finish in the 400 hurdles at the San Diego State Aztec Invitational (behind only a Division I hurdler from Wisconsin) and helping the 4x400 relay to a first-place finish ... Had a fifth-place finish in the 400 hurdles at the Pomona-Pitzer Invitational (54.60). 

2017-18 (First-Year)
Earned top times of 53.36 in the 400 hurdles and 49.99 in the 400 meters as a freshman ... Won his heat in the 400h at the 2018 SCIAC Championships with a 55.65 before finishing fifth in the finals ... Ran in both the 4x100 and 4x400 relays in the 2018 SCIAC Championships ... Had a PR in the 400 meters of 49.99 at the third SCIAC Multi-Dual to come in second, while winning the 400 hurdles on the same day (55.72). 

Prior to CMS
Attended Stuart Hall, where he was a member of the track and wrestling teams ... Finished in the top 40 in the state in wrestling.
